Today I was very keen on getting the website for one of my clients at least to this stage, that I can show him that all requested items has been fulfilled. Now it only comes to do little changes here and there. Luckily I learned something through this process again … I have found 2 very useful WordPress plugins.
- You want to add some pages but don’t want them to be listed in the top navigation menu? You can add some exclusion arguments to the PHP code in header.php .. OR you can just activate the plugin WP Hide Pages.
- You want to simply add a slideshow to your post/page or sidebar? Check out the plugin WP-Cycle … it makes things sooo much easier. This plugin creates an image slideshow from the images you upload using the jQuery Cycle plugin.
